What is Digital Marketing?

Digital marketing refers to the advertisement of offerings using digital tools, mainly on the internet but also encompassing mobile phones, display advertising, and other digital media. The core strength of digital marketing comes from its capability to reach precise audiences and measure results accurately, in real time.

With over 4.9 billion internet users globally, digital marketing has become an indispensable part of every brand’s strategy. Marketers use search engines, social media platforms, email campaigns, and websites to target prospects, tailoring messages according to user metrics, behaviors, and demographics. This customized approach not only improves engagement but also maximizes returns.

The Role of Advertising in Digital Marketing

One of the key components of digital marketing is advertising. Digital advertising includes promoting products or services through different online channels, such as search engines (Google Ads), social media platforms (Facebook, Instagram, LinkedIn), or display networks. These platforms allow businesses to craft highly focused ads based on factors like age, location, interests, and past internet behaviors.
As opposed to traditional advertising techniques like TV and radio, digital advertising delivers unrivaled precision and budget-friendliness. Key kinds of digital advertising include:

• Search Engine Advertising (Pay-Per-Click): Advertisers bid for ad spots in search engine results pages, targeting specific keywords associated with their products or services.
• Social Media Advertising: Social media platforms offer refined audience targeting functions, allowing businesses to connect with their audience through paid posts and sponsored ads.
• Display Advertising: Banner ads, interactive ads, and video ads that are displayed on websites, apps, and other digital properties.}

With live analytics, businesses can track the effectiveness of their ads, tweak campaigns, and enhance budgets in response to immediate data. This responsiveness allows for a more dynamic approach to marketing.

Affiliate Marketing: A Powerful Revenue Stream

Affiliate marketing is another important component of digital marketing, delivering a performance-based payment model where affiliates (third-party partners) market a business's products or services in exchange for a commission. This strategy is especially widespread among e-commerce companies and bloggers, as it allows brands to use outside networks to expand their reach.

How does it function? Affiliates use referral links or unique promotional codes to send users to a business’s website. Whenever a transaction is made, or a specific activity (like a sign-up) is completed through this link, the affiliate earns a commission. As opposed to traditional advertising, businesses only reward affiliates when they generate conversions, making it a budget-friendly model.

Benefits of affiliate marketing include:
• Low upfront costs: Since affiliate marketing is performance-based, companies don’t provide payment to affiliates until a conversion occurs, reducing financial risk.
• Scalability: As businesses expand, they can bring in more affiliates to market their products, constantly expanding their reach without significant additional investments.
• Increased trust and credibility: Affiliates, often bloggers, already hold a trusted audience that trusts their recommendations, making it easier to convert leads into sales.
